MyBatis提供了两种忽略字段映射的方法: 1. 使用`@Transient`注解:在实体类的属性上添加`@Transient`注解,表示该属性不参与数据库字段的映射。这种方式适用于单个属性的情况......
MyBatis中的saveOrUpdate方法用于在数据库中保存或更新一个对象。在使用这个方法之前,需要先配置好MyBatis的基本配置文件和映射文件。 使用步骤如下: 1. 创建一个实体类,并在......
MyBatis是一个持久层框架,用于与数据库进行交互。要删除表数据,你可以按照以下步骤进行操作: 1. 在你的MyBatis配置文件中配置数据库连接信息。 2. 创建一个与数据库表对应的Java实体......
要提高MyBatis批量更新的效率,可以考虑以下几点: 1. 使用批量更新语句:MyBatis提供了批量操作的支持,可以使用``标签来实现批量更新操作。通过将多个更新操作合并为一条SQL语句,可以减......
Spring Boot集成MyBatis的原理是通过使用Spring Boot提供的自动配置机制,自动配置MyBatis相关的组件,并将其注册到Spring容器中。 具体来说,Spring Boot......
整合Spring Boot和MyBatis的步骤如下: 1. 创建Spring Boot项目:使用Spring Initializr创建一个Maven项目,并添加必要的依赖,包括Spring Boo......
要将 MyBatis 的日志打印到文件中,你可以按照以下步骤进行操作: 1. 首先,确保你的项目中已经引入了 `slf4j` 和 `logback` 的依赖。这两个库可以帮助你进行日志管理和打印。 ......
在MyBatis中,可以使用``标签来判断一个List是否为空或null。 示例代码如下: ```xml SELECT * FROM users WHERE id IN #......
在MyBatis中配置多个数据源可以通过使用多个`<environment>`标签来实现。每个`<environment>`标签代表一个数据源,您可以为每个数据源指定不同的属性......
在MyBatis中,可以使用``标签来实现`IN`条件的传参。 以下是一个示例,展示了如何在MyBatis中使用``标签来传递`IN`条件的参数: 首先,在Mapper.xml文件中定义一个``标......